Tantum religio potuit suadere malorum.
Lucretius (c. 100-c. 55 BC) Roman poet [Titus Luretius Carus]
[Such are the evils made acceptable by Religion!]
De Rerum Natura [On the Nature of Things], I.101

Look at a man in the midst of doubt and danger, and you will lean in his hour of adversity what he really is. It is then that true utterances are wrung from the recesses of his breast. The mask is torn off; the reality remains.
Lucretius (c. 100-c. 55 BC) Roman poet [Titus Luretius Carus]
De Rerum Natura [On the Nature of Things], II.55
tr. R.E. Latham (1951)
